Job Description

The Graphic Designer 3 role at client focuses on driving the visual appearance of products and branded communications. The position plays a critical part in developing original graphic designs that align with the company's brand ethos and supports cross-functional teams through various project phases, from ideation to final production. This is a graphics-focused role, requiring hands‑on involvement in print, packaging, 3D retail displays, event signage, logo systems, imagery, and collateral materials, as well as active file and project management in a fast-paced environment.
